存在2个mysql docker镜像 - 一个是“官方”:https://hub.docker.com/_/mysql/
和一个“由Oracle团队创建,维护和支持”:https://hub.docker.com/r/mysql/mysql-server/
两个图像之间的文档几乎完全相同。预期的ENV变量几乎相同。
使用其中一个是否有任何优势?
答案 0 :(得分:6)
2张图片并不完全相同,“官方”图片基于Debian(参见Dockerfile),而Oracle的图片基于Oracle Linux(参见Dockerfile)。两者都基于社区包。
我不能推荐图像或其他图像,它是基于Debian或RedHat的发行版之间的个人偏好。入口点不同。如果你看到它们之间存在明显的差异,它可能是决定性的(看起来并不深刻,但官方的入口点似乎更具特色)。